MAXINT = 2147483647
:0
* -1000^0
* $ $MAXINT^0
* 1^1 B ?? ^^\/(.*$?)*
{ B_chunkB = $MATCH }
Real nice.
How much time does the looping take? It should be
compared against building a variable of about a
1000 dots and using that as a regexp.
dots = "................" # 16
dots = $dots$dots$dots$dots # 64
dots = $dots$dots$dots$dots # 256
:0
*$ B_chunkA ^^\/$dots$dots$dots$dots
{ B_chunkA = $MATCH }
dots # unset
Well, you won't get a match with that if there is a short
body.
